public dvt(Context paramContext, Cursor paramCursor, String paramString1, String paramString2, cfm paramcfm, String paramString3, String[] paramArrayOfString) { super(paramCursor, paramArrayOfString); d = paramString1; e = paramString2; f = paramcfm; g = paramContext; h = paramString3; i = paramCursor.getColumnIndexOrThrow("_id"); j = paramCursor.getColumnIndexOrThrow("messageId"); k = paramCursor.getColumnIndexOrThrow("conversation"); l = paramCursor.getColumnIndexOrThrow("subject"); m = paramCursor.getColumnIndexOrThrow("snippet"); n = paramCursor.getColumnIndexOrThrow("fromAddress"); o = paramCursor.getColumnIndexOrThrow("customFromAddress"); p = paramCursor.getColumnIndexOrThrow("toAddresses"); q = paramCursor.getColumnIndexOrThrow("ccAddresses"); r = paramCursor.getColumnIndexOrThrow("bccAddresses"); s = paramCursor.getColumnIndexOrThrow("replyToAddresses"); t = paramCursor.getColumnIndexOrThrow("dateReceivedMs"); u = paramCursor.getColumnIndexOrThrow("body"); v = paramCursor.getColumnIndexOrThrow("stylesheet"); w = paramCursor.getColumnIndexOrThrow("stylesheetRestrictor"); x = paramCursor.getColumnIndexOrThrow("bodyEmbedsExternalResources"); y = paramCursor.getColumnIndexOrThrow("labelIds"); z = paramCursor.getColumnIndexOrThrow("refMessageId"); A = paramCursor.getColumnIndexOrThrow("isDraft"); B = paramCursor.getColumnIndexOrThrow("forward"); C = paramCursor.getColumnIndexOrThrow("joinedAttachmentInfos"); D = paramCursor.getColumnIndexOrThrow("isUnread"); E = paramCursor.getColumnIndexOrThrow("isStarred"); F = paramCursor.getColumnIndexOrThrow("isInOutbox"); G = paramCursor.getColumnIndexOrThrow("isInSending"); H = paramCursor.getColumnIndexOrThrow("isInFailed"); I = paramCursor.getColumnIndexOrThrow("quoteStartPos"); J = paramCursor.getColumnIndexOrThrow("spamDisplayedReasonType"); K = paramCursor.getColumnIndexOrThrow("clipped"); L = paramCursor.getColumnIndexOrThrow("permalink"); N = paramCursor.getColumnIndexOrThrow("unsubscribeSenderIdentifier"); M = paramCursor.getColumnIndexOrThrow("isSenderUnsubscribed"); O = 0; P = 0; Q = 0; T = 0; R = 0; S = 0; U = 0; V = paramCursor.getColumnIndexOrThrow("hasEvent"); W = paramCursor.getColumnIndexOrThrow("eventTitle"); X = paramCursor.getColumnIndexOrThrow("startTime"); Y = paramCursor.getColumnIndexOrThrow("endTime"); Z = paramCursor.getColumnIndexOrThrow("allDay"); aa = paramCursor.getColumnIndexOrThrow("location"); ab = paramCursor.getColumnIndexOrThrow("organizer"); ac = paramCursor.getColumnIndexOrThrow("attendees"); ad = paramCursor.getColumnIndexOrThrow("icalMethod"); ae = paramCursor.getColumnIndexOrThrow("responder"); af = paramCursor.getColumnIndexOrThrow("responseStatus"); ag = paramCursor.getColumnIndexOrThrow("eventId"); ah = paramCursor.getColumnIndexOrThrow("showUnauthWarning"); ai = paramCursor.getColumnIndexOrThrow("isLateReclassified"); paramContext = super.getExtras(); paramCursor = new Bundle(); int i1 = i2; if (paramContext.containsKey("status")) { int i3 = paramContext.getInt("status"); i1 = i2; if (a.get(i3) != null) { i1 = ((Integer)a.get(i3)).intValue(); } } paramCursor.putInt("cursor_status", i1); aq = paramCursor; ar = TextUtils.split(ghz.a(g.getContentResolver(), "gmail_senders_excluded_from_block_option", "*****@*****.**"), ","); }